Equation: y=mx+b
If m= slope
b= y-intercept
what is x and y???

x and y are the x and y point on the graph

lets say they gave you the point (2,y) 2 would be x, and they want you to find what number y is


all you do is plug 2 in for x in that equation and solve for y
